Output abaf09c6d2ba83c7c613fbea617b946d023591763ab3a700fadaa7dda6792e15:0

value
935583106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 213aebc9c62c12889a4922280468d9f284a52753 OP_EQUAL
address
34iionDEN2mdKvrbovCt9AzPhaqexpEfKQ
transaction
abaf09c6d2ba83c7c613fbea617b946d023591763ab3a700fadaa7dda6792e15
confirmations
508921
spent
true